Understanding Big Data Science: Techniques, Applications, and Benefits

Understanding Big Data Science: Techniques, Applications, and Benefits

Big data science refers to the analysis and interpretation of large, complex datasets that traditional data processing tools cannot adequately handle. Utilizing advanced technologies and methods, big data science combines elements of computer science, statistics, and domain-specific know-how to extract insights and knowledge from vast datasets. This comprehensive guide will explore the fundamental concepts, applications, and benefits of big data science.

What is Big Data Science?

Big data science involves advanced techniques for managing, processing, and extracting valuable insights from massive volumes of complex data. Unlike traditional data processing methods, big data science employs sophisticated algorithms, machine learning, and statistical analysis to handle data that is beyond the scope of conventional tools.

Interdisciplinary Field of Data Science

Data science is an interdisciplinary field that encompasses statistics, scientific research, algorithms, statistical analysis, and artificial intelligence (AI) functionalities. A key feature of data science is its adaptability to various fields, making it an essential tool for numerous industries, including social media, medicine, security, healthcare, social sciences, biological sciences, engineering, defense, business, economics, finance, marketing, and geolocation.

The Role of a Data Scientist

Data scientists play a crucial role in handling data management and interpreting data for decision-making. They are responsible for:

Collecting larger amounts of data sets Solving business-related problems Working with different computer languages Initiating collaboration between IT and business professionals

Techniques Used in Big Data Science

The techniques employed in big data science include:

Machine Learning: A powerful method for predictive analytics and pattern recognition. Statistical Analysis: Essential for extracting meaningful insights and patterns from data. Data Ingestion: Gathering and processing data from various sources. Data Storage: Managing and storing large volumes of data efficiently. Data Analysis: Utilizing advanced analytics to derive actionable insights.

Applications of Big Data Science

Big data science finds applications in numerous fields, including:

Predictive Analytics: Forecasting future trends and behaviors based on historical data. Machine Learning: Automating decision-making processes and improving accuracy. Data-Driven Decision-Making: Utilizing data to inform strategic business decisions.

Benefits of Big Data Analytics

The use of big data analytics offers several significant benefits:

Efficient Business Processes: Increased efficiency and optimization of workflows. Informed Risk Management: Improved risk assessment techniques based on large data samples. Enhanced Consumer Insights: Deeper understanding of customer behavior, demands, and sentiment. Strategic Decision-Making: Better product development, data, and process management.

By leveraging big data science, organizations can gain a competitive edge in today's data-driven world. Whether it is through predictive analytics, machine learning, or data-driven decision-making, harnessing the power of big data can lead to significant improvements in various sectors.
